The Mechanism of the Reaction of 2-Bromo-N,N-dimethyl-2,2-diphenylacetamide and Sodium Methoxide in 2,2-Dimethoxypropane. A Method for Establishing the Radical-Anion Radical Chain Mechanism Thermolysis of N,N-dimethyl-2,2-diphenyl-2-(phenylazo)acetamide (1, X = C6H5NN–) in the presence of sodium methoxide in 2,2-dimethoxypropane furnishes N,N-dimethyl-2,2-diphenylacetamide (1, X = H), the dimeric product 3, and 2-hydroxymethyl-2,2-diphenylacetamide (1, X = -CH2OH). An analysis of this result leads to the conclusion that the title reaction, which yields compounds 1 (X = H) and 3, is a radical-anion radical chain process.
